A variable pressure two-body hydrostatic experimental device
By designing a variable pressure dual-body hydrostatic experimental device, eliminating the water valve and using a one-way air bladder and U-shaped tube liquid column display, the problems of space occupation and cumbersome operation of the experimental device were solved, and the convenience and efficiency of the experiment were achieved.

[0045] The principle of this invention: Due to the nature of the operating components, most existing fluid statics experimental devices need to be placed on an experimental platform and cannot be placed directly on a podium, which occupies a lot of experimental space and causes unnecessary waste of resources. In addition, when reducing the air pressure in the water tank during the experiment, the bottom drain valve needs to be opened to release water, making the overall experimental operation cumbersome. Moreover, the existing fluid statics experimental devices are single devices, that is, there is only one water tank, and only one set of data can be obtained in a single operation. In order to obtain multiple sets of data, multiple experiments need to be carried out, which consumes a lot of experimental time and results in low experimental efficiency. In this embodiment of the invention, the water valve that creates the pressure drop phenomenon in existing equipment is eliminated. One-way first air bladder 4 and second air bladder 5 are used to change the gas pressure in the first measuring chamber 2 and the second measuring chamber 3 of the main chamber 1. Because the lower water valve is eliminated, this embodiment of the invention can be placed directly on a test bench or desk. The elimination of the support frame design prevents the base from oxidizing due to water corrosion, effectively protecting the cleanliness of the experimental table. The change in the height of the liquid column in the first U-shaped tube 6 and the second U-shaped tube 7, which are connected to the side wall of the main chamber 1, is used for display. This allows experiments to be conducted simultaneously in both the first and second measuring chambers 3 within the main chamber 1, simplifying the operation steps while increasing the data obtained per operation, effectively saving time and cost and improving experimental efficiency. The main chamber 1 has a first inlet 8 and a second inlet 9, which are used not only for the release and entry of water from the tank but also for balancing the air pressure inside and outside the tank during the experiment.
[0046] The first U-shaped tube 6, the second U-shaped tube 7, the first pressure measuring tube 24, and the second pressure measuring tube 25 are all transparent tubes. In the experiment to verify the equation of incompressible hydrostatics (i.e., using the experimental device in this embodiment of the invention), the experimental liquid (represented by liquid water directly below) is first injected into the first measuring chamber 2 and the second measuring chamber 3 inside the main housing 1 through the first injection port 8 and the second injection port 9. Note that the final liquid level in the two chambers should not exceed the diameter height of the openings of the first U-shaped tube 6 and the second U-shaped tube 7 that connect to the main housing 1, that is, liquid water should not enter the first U-shaped tube 6 or the second U-shaped tube 7. Then, liquid water is injected from the free ends of the first U-shaped tube 6 and the second U-shaped tube 7. The preparation work before the experiment is completed. When the experimental data measurement begins, the liquid position in the first U-shaped tube 6, the second U-shaped tube 7, the first pressure measuring tube 24, and the second pressure measuring tube 25 is first recorded with chalk or a pen. After the measurement is completed, the first injection port 8 and the second injection port 9 are sealed with the sealing element 10. Then, the first air bladder 4 is pressed by hand. The gas enters the first measuring chamber 2, increasing the pressure inside. The liquid columns in the first U-shaped tube 6 and the first pressure measuring tube 24 rise. Releasing the first air pump 4 allows gas from the second measuring chamber 3 to enter the first air pump 4, reducing the amount of gas in the second measuring chamber 3 and lowering its pressure. This causes the liquid columns in the second U-shaped tube 7 and the second pressure measuring tube 25 to fall. The experimental data is recorded and remarked with a pen, or a ruler can be used to directly record the liquid level using the tabletop as a reference. Then, the second air pump is pressed by hand. Gas from the second inflator bladder 5 enters the second measuring chamber 3, increasing the pressure within it. This causes the liquid columns in the second U-tube 7 and the second pressure measuring tube 25 to rise. Releasing the second inflator bladder 5 allows gas from the first measuring chamber 2 to enter the second inflator bladder 5, reducing the volume of gas in the first measuring chamber 2 and lowering its pressure. This causes the liquid columns in the first U-tube 6 and the first pressure measuring tube 24 to fall. Experimental data is recorded, allowing for two sets of experimental data to be obtained from a single experiment. Multiple data measurements can be performed following the same procedure. This invention improves the water tank pressure regulation system, reducing the steps involved in changing the pressure through waterproofing in existing technologies. In principle, this change does not affect the experimental phenomena or results; it essentially alters the pressure within the water tank. However, the operation of this invention is simpler and cleaner, and data measurement is faster, effectively saving time and costs and improving classroom experiment efficiency. Furthermore, this device can demonstrate the working principle of a U-tube manometer. Both the first inflator bladder 4 and the second inflator bladder 5 are unidirectional inflators.

[0063] In some embodiments of the present invention, the first airbag 4 is provided with a second valve 26, and the second airbag 5 is provided with a third valve 27.
[0064] In the above embodiment, when the experimenter presses the first air bladder 4 by hand, the second valve 26 on the first air bladder 4 opens, and the third valve 27 on the second air bladder 5 closes. This design is to prevent the gas from bursting open the second air bladder 5 due to increased pressure when the air pressure in the first measuring chamber 2 increases, thus preventing air leakage. When the experimenter presses the second air bladder 5 by hand, the third valve 27 on the second air bladder 5 opens, and the second valve 26 on the first air bladder 4 closes. This design is to prevent the gas from bursting open the first air bladder 4 due to increased pressure when the air pressure in the second measuring chamber 3 increases, thus preventing air leakage. This design can, to a certain extent, enhance the gas sealing effect of the first air bladder 4 and the second air bladder 5 when they are not in operation, ensuring the accuracy of the experiment.
